CUC to conduct water meter accuracy testing

(CUC) — The Commonwealth Utilities Corporation will begin a comprehensive water meter testing initiative on Saipan starting Tuesday, Jan. 21, 2025.  This testing program aims to ensure the accuracy of water meters that have been in service for over five years, reflecting CUC’s commitment to delivering safe, reliable, and quality services to its customers.

As part of the process, CUC will perform random accuracy testing on selected water meters. Customers whose meters are selected for testing will have their current water meters temporarily replaced with a certified temporary meter. The original meter will undergo calibration at CUC’s facility to verify its accuracy.

Meters that pass the accuracy test will be returned to service, and the temporary meters will be removed. Meters that do not meet accuracy standards will be replaced with new water meters to ensure precise measurements and billing.
